Description

Take advantage of this stunning barn conversion coming to market in the peaceful, rural village of Gosberton Bank. This beautifully renovated barn exudes character, with vaulted ceilings and a tasteful, neutral décor. Rarely available in the South Holland area, this spacious home offers a fantastic plot with ample parking and a detached double garage. Enjoy far-reaching field views to both front and rear, as well as spacious downstairs living and four large bedrooms upstairs. The master suite boasts an en-suite, while two further bedrooms feature private balconies overlooking the beautiful Lincolnshire countryside.

Kitchen/Diner - 5.92m x 4.73m (19'5" x 15'6") - Double glazed windows to all aspects. Feature beam. Fitted kitchen comprising of base and eye level units and an island unit with storage under and space for seating around. Range master cooker with extractor hood over. Space and plumbing for dishwasher. Fridge freezer with storage cupboards around. Ceramic style sink with mixer tap over. Recessed spotlights. Radiator. Tiled flooring.



Rear Lobby - Double glazed French doors opening to the garden. Door to utility room. Open plan to dining room. Tiled flooring.



Utility Room - 2.12m x 1.71m (6'11" x 5'7") - Space and plumbing for washing machine with worktop over. Wall cupboards. Door to cloakroom.



Cloakroom - Double glazed window to side. Fitted with a two piece suite comprising of toilet. Wash hand basin. Radiator. Tiled flooring.



Lounge - 5.85m x 4.73m (19'2" x 15'6") - Dual aspect double glazed windows. Multi fuel stove, two radiators, double glazed windows, PVC double glazed French doors to rear garden.



Dining Hall - 5.75m x 4.78m (18'10" x 15'8") - Barn style doors to front. Dual aspect double glazed windows. Vaulted ceiling. Exposed beams. Stairs leading to first floor. Tiled flooring.



First Floor Landing - 7.96m x 1.76m (26'1" x 5'9") - Double glazed window. Galleried landing. Two radiators. Built in airing cupboard housing hot water cylinder.



Bedroom 1 - 3.95m x 4.75m (12'11" x 15'7") - Dual aspect feature double glazed arched windows. Exposed beam. Built in wardrobe. Radiator. French doors out to a decked balcony with views out over the rear courtyard and garden beyond.



En-Suite - 1.90m x 2.54m (6'2" x 8'3") - Feature window. Large shower enclosure with wall mounted Aqualisa shower. Wash hand basin set in vanity unit. Toilet. Radiator.



Balcony - 1.83m x 2.81m (6'0" x 9'2") -



Bedroom 2 - 3.07m x 4.74m (10'0" x 15'6") - Double glazed dual aspect windows. Exposed beam. Radiator. Door out to decked balcony with views over front garden and fields beyond.



Balcony - 2.16m x 2.10m (7'1" x 6'10") -



Bedroom 3 - 2.68m x 2.97m (8'9" x 9'8") - Double glazed feature window. Exposed beam. Radiator.



Bedroom 4 - 2.55m x 2.86m (8'4" x 9'4") - Two double glazed Velux windows. Exposed beam. Radiator.



Bathroom - 2.26m x 2.85m (7'4" x 9'4") - Double glazed Velux window. Fitted with a three piece suite comprising of a bath with glass shower screen and wall mounted shower over. Toilet. Pedestal wash hand basin. Radiator. Half height wall cladding.



Outside - The driveway to the side of the property is accessed via large double timber gates which open out to a gravel driveway with parking for multiple vehicles. The driveway leads to the double garage.
The property has gardens to the front side and rear. The side garden has well stocked raised sleeper beds, patio seating areas and a lean to pergola.
The rear garden is accessed via an arched hedge and is mainly laid to lawn with mature borders. Vegetable plot. Pond and rockery.



Double Garage - 5.22m x 5.85m (17'1" x 19'2") - Double garage with timber doors. Eaves storage space. Power and light connected.



Location - Gosberton Bank is a peaceful rural hamlet on the edge of Gosberton, just a short drive or walk away from the village, which has everything a family needs—like a doctor’s surgery, a dentist, a Co-op shop, a lovely tea room, a great butcher, and a church, plus a big park perfect for children. From Gosberton Bank, it’s also just a short drive to the Spalding Golf Club in Surfleet, which is located near the A16, and recently upgraded to attract more visitors. Plus, you’re only 15 minutes away from Spalding, a charming market town with excellent transport links and a vibrant high street. This makes Gosberton Bank the perfect balance of rural tranquillity and easy access to local amenities and leisure.

Spalding Golf Club - Spalding Golf Club is one of Lincolnshire’s most respected courses, offering a welcoming atmosphere for players of all abilities. Set amidst beautiful parkland beside the River Glen, the 18-hole course is known for its scenic fairways, mature trees, and well-maintained greens that provide an enjoyable challenge throughout the year. The club also features excellent practice facilities, a pro shop, and a friendly clubhouse with food and refreshments available. Currently, Spalding Golf Club is undergoing exciting extension and improvement works, further enhancing its facilities and member experience - ensuring it remains a top destination for golfers in the area.

Anti-Money Laundering (Aml) Checks - If you wish to proceed with an offer on this property, we are required under HMRC regulations to carry out anti-money laundering (AML) checks for all prospective buyers and sellers. We take this responsibility seriously and ensure that all checks are conducted securely and in line with current guidelines. To facilitate this process, our trusted partner, Coadjute, will manage the verification on our behalf. Once an offer has been accepted (subject to contract), Coadjute will send you a secure link to complete the biometric identification checks electronically.

Please note that a non-refundable fee of £27 + VAT per person applies for this service, with payment processed directly through Coadjute.

These AML checks must be completed before we are able to issue the memorandum of sale to the solicitors confirming the transaction. If you have any questions regarding this process, please do not hesitate to contact our office.
